COIN

Unique ID: BUC-2B6848

Object type certainty: Certain
Workflow status: Published Find published

A copper-alloy Roman coin, probably an as, of Caracalla (AD 198-217), possibly dating to the period AD 215-217 (Reece period 10). Reverse type possibly depicting Sol mounting a quadriga left. Mint of Rome. Cf. RIC IV.2, p. 305, no. 556; BMC p.490, no. 297§ for the possibly reverse type.
